What Are Freezer Labels and Why Do You Need Them?

Freezer labels are specially designed to withstand freezing temperatures while staying firmly attached to various surfaces, such as plastic containers, glass jars, or metal surfaces. Unlike standard labels, they feature specialized freezer grade adhesive labels that resist peeling or degradation in subzero conditions. Freezer labels ensure clear and durable identification of your frozen items, a necessity in both commercial and home environments.

Here’s why freezer labels are indispensable: they prevent misidentification, ensure proper food rotation, and comply with industry regulations in food and pharmaceutical sectors. Whether you’re labeling homemade meals, ingredients, or industrially frozen items, reliable labels tailored for freezing conditions make all the difference.

Key Features of Premium Freezer Labels

For effective storage labeling, freezer labels must possess specific attributes to maintain their functionality in cold, damp, and humid environments. Here are crucial features to consider:

  • Waterproof and Moisture-resistant: Labels such as freezer safe rectangle stickers are designed to resist water exposure that often occurs due to condensation inside freezers.
  • Temperature Range: Quality labels must adhere securely at both freezing and thawing temperatures without losing integrity.
  • Durability: Labels should withstand friction, chemicals, and freezer abrasions over time.
  • Easy Application and Removability: Options like removable freezer labels balance secure adhesion with effortless removal, leaving no residue behind.
  • Readability: Custom freezer labels offer excellent print quality, ensuring text and visuals remain legible even in extreme conditions.

Expert Tips for Utilizing Freezer Labels Effectively

Drawing from decades of industry experience at Sticker Printing Co UK, these actionable tips will help you make the most of your freezer labeling efforts:

  1. Choose the Right Material: Labels made from waterproof materials perform best in cold and damp environments.
  2. Temperature Matching: Always ensure your label’s adhesive corresponds to the temperature of your freezer.
  3. Proper Placement: Affix labels securely to smooth, clean, and dry surfaces for optimal adherence.
  4. Test Before Full Application: When working with freezer labels printable, print a small batch and test for durability in actual freezing conditions.
  5. Regular Inspection: Periodically check labels for wear and tear to ensure accuracy and readability.
